Episodes
After a devastating tragedy, Joe and Frank Hardy move to Bridgepoint to spend the summer with Aunt Trudy; the boys discover their father has taken on a secret investigation and take it upon themselves to start an investigation of their own.
Joe and Frank's father heads overseas to find Mrs. Khan's nephew, Rupert; Frank discovers an old note of his mother's in Bridgeport that mentions the sunken fishing boat; Joe and Biff befriend a man on the beach who asks them to deliver a message.
Joe finds a strange golden idol hidden in his room; later, he gets lucky at the Bridgeport Fair, but he also draws the attention of the Tall Man; Frank discovers some information about an old mining expedition that ended in tragedy.
When the thief's campsite is discovered, Joe is terrified that the toolbox he loaned the man on the beach has been found by the police; Joe enlists Biff to help him get his monogrammed soldering iron out of evidence at the police department.
Joe and Frank decode a message that leads them to try and make a drop at the warehouse; when the Tall Man escapes from the hospital, the boys reveal their entire investigation to their friends and get their help to lure the Tall Man to Chet's farm.
Frank takes the entrance exam to the preparatory school; Callie Shaw is also taking the test, and the two work together to solve the exam's escape room puzzle in Gloria's study; they discover a hidden door, marked by a symbol they've seen before.
Frank learns the dean of Rosegrave Preparatory School had a connection to his mother; Joe and Biff continue to investigate the scrap of fabric from the warehouse; Mrs. Khan makes a play for the missing piece of The Eye by enlisting the Tall Man.
Frank befriends Stacy, the new girl in town; the Hardy boys start the school year in Bridgeport; Frank discovers his mother used to write for the high school paper; J.B. Cox tries to put the squeeze on Joe to find out what he knows about The Eye.
When J.B. Cox offers Joe up to Gloria, he is hired to find the other two pieces of The Eye; Joe's lucky charm goes missing, and Aunt Trudy uncovers the boys' investigation; Frank and Joe discover their mother's music box holds a secret.
After gaining access to George Estabrook's secret room, Frank and Joe take their great-grandfather's journal and maps to learn more about The Eye; despite Frank warning them of danger, Joe and Biff strike out alone to find the Chamber of the Eye.
